If the Quillpress markdown pipeline stalls and on-call engineering at Harrowgate is unreachable, support may invoke break-glass access. This grants temporary admin rights to restart the sanitizer, flush the render cache, and requeue stuck documents. Use it only when customer-facing pages fail to render for more than fifteen minutes. Every invocation is logged and reviewed the next business day by the Tellwick platform team. To unlock the break-glass console, enter the recovery passphrase shown below.

vault phrase of hahop-hawef = ralael-ralath-aldok

Subject: Gallery labels — Hallowmere wing

Dispatch — printed museum labels for the new Hallowmere gallery are boxed and ready at the Fenwick print room. 312 labels, four crates, fragile mounts. Driver from Oswin Carriers collects tomorrow, 07:45, rear loading bay. No substitutions on the route; labels must arrive before installers at 10:00. Coordinator: brief your driver before departure and pass along this instruction at hand-over:

dispatch memo: the lamwyn fenwyn courier leaves the wenir ledger at gate 7175 under passcode 822969

Subject: Tax-rate lookup cache — ready for release review

Hi Soren,

The new caching layer for the Ledgerline tax-rate lookup is staged and soaked for 48 hours. Hit rate is holding at 94%, and invalidation on jurisdiction updates propagates within two minutes, verified against the Bramford test dataset. Rollback plan: flip the cache-bypass flag, no redeploy needed. I'd like your go-ahead for Thursday's train. The candidate build token is below.

pipeline stamp: htk4_b7f3

For the upcoming release, be aware that our notification vendor Pushgrove enforces per-tenant rate caps on their fan-out API. During the Meridia launch we saturated those caps and their broker began shedding low-priority messages silently. They have since added a backpressure signal we now honor in the dispatcher, but releases that spike notification volume should be staged over at least two hours. If you expect a burst beyond 50k notifications per minute, their integrations team must approve a temporary cap raise.

pager mailbox: druwyn@norvaio.corp